Dark olive green (#556B2F) and Drab dark brown (#4A412A) appear together across 6 master palettes in our corpus, most prominently in the work of Anton Mauve, Richard Gerstl, and Isaac Levitan and the Realism tradition. Painters typically deployed dark olive green at an average of 23% of the canvas, with drab dark brown at 14%. Third colors most often completing the combination include Pine green (#2A2F23), Shadow (#8A795D), and Gold Fusion (#85754E).
